It was announced on Sunday 31st January that the Bishop of Coventry has appointed David Stone to be the next Canon Residentiary and Precentor of Coventry Cathedral.
After seven and a half years as Team Rector of Newbury, David will be moving to begin work in Coventry in June, though his formal installation in Coventry Cathedral will not take place until September 5th. His final Sunday in Newbury is likely to be May 16th.
In the announcement made in all the churches of the Newbury Team, David said, "Buff, Timothy, Alastair and I have very much enjoyed our time in Newbury and will be sorry to leave the delights of this part of the world. But we sense that this is the right time to be moving on and believe that God has clearly led us to take on this fresh challenge and exciting opportunity. Please pray for us as a family - as we shall pray for you in the unfolding adventure of all that God has for you in the future."
The Bishop of Coventry, the Right Reverend Dr Christopher Cocksworth, said, "David Stone's wide experience and abilities will be a great gift to all those who experience the ministry of Coventry Cathedral, day by day or for great and magnificent occasions. He is a reconciler, communicator and teacher with a keen interest in developing worship that reflects the richness of our traditions as well as the realities of life in the twenty-first century. I am looking forward to welcoming him and his family to our cathedral, city and diocese."
